摘要

Abstract

This paper is focused on the optimal policy selection for moving target defense.Attack-defense confronta tion in moving target defense environment is analyzed.Reward quantization method of moving target defense policy is proposed.Single-stage and multi-stage moving target defense game models are constructed based on the dynamic game with incomplete information.The algorithm to obtain perfect Bayesian equilibrium and the method to revise prior belief are proposed.Optimal moving target defense policies are obtained under different security situations.Finally,not only the feasibility and effectiveness of the proposed model and method are illustrated and verified in a representative example but also general rules of network defense using moving target defense policies are summarized.
